WebbIt’s stuck. Here’s How A Thermostatic Radiator Valve Works. Inside the thermostatic valve is a pin which rises and falls as you turn the valve on/off. As you open the valve the pin rises and allows more hot water to flow into the radiator making it hot. This pin can get stuck, particularly through summer when it’s not being used. Thermostatic valves will automatically turn off your radiator when the temperature in the room has reached an acceptable level and will allow it to heat up again once this has been achieved.
